From: Accounting for treatment use when validating a prognostic model: a simulation study

Fig. 4:

Calibration curves calculated in a treated validation set, following different approaches to account for the effects of treatment, in the presence of an unmeasured predictor (U) associated with both the outcome and the probability of receiving treatment. Scenario 13: U has a weak association with the outcome (log(OR) = 1); scenario 14: U has a moderate association with the outcome (log(OR) = 2); scenario 15: U has a strong association with the outcome (log(OR) = 4). Plots were based on sets of 1 million individuals.
